Candat Island Beach, located in Linapacan, Palawan, is known for its pristine white-sand shores and crystal-clear waters. It offers an idyllic getaway from bustling urban life, with opportunities for relaxation and exploration. The beach is part of a larger group of islets, providing a serene and natural setting perfect for sunbathing, swimming, and water activities. Its scenic beauty attracts nature lovers and those seeking tranquility.

The area around Candat Island is rich in marine life, making it a great spot for snorkeling and spotting local wildlife. Linapacan Island itself is relatively unspoiled, offering an authentic experience of nature and island culture.

Visitors can combine beach activities with local exploration, such as visiting nearby islands like Patoyo and Ariara, which offer additional opportunities for island hopping and sightseeing.

Linapacan Island, where Candat Island Beach is situated, has been included in the list of '35 Clearest Waters in the World to Swim in Before You Die'. The island group is known for its pristine beaches and unspoiled natural attractions, making it a hidden gem for travelers looking for a serene tropical experience. The local culture and history add another layer of interest, with the island hosting a mix of modern and traditional island life.

The primary attractions around Candat Island Beach include the island's stunning natural beauty and its surrounding islets. Visitors can explore nearby beaches, go snorkeling in the marine sanctuaries, or visit historical sites like the Spanish fort at Caseledan. The area is also a great spot for island hopping tours, providing access to other pristine beaches and lagoons. Ginto Island, another nearby attraction, offers further opportunities for exploring natural wonders.
